Abstract
Chemoselective hydrogenation Of unsaturated carbonyl compounds over Groups 8 and 9 titania-supported metal catalysts was investigated in a pulse reactor. It is shown that when a conjugated aldehyde such as crotonaldehyde is hydrogenated, a high temperature reduction enchances the selectivity of the iridium and ruthenium catalysts in the formation of the unsaturated alcohol, which suggests that decoration of metal particles by titania sub-oxides generates new catalytic sites selective for carbonyl group hydrogenation. However, such behaviour is not observed for the unsaturated ketones.
